National Genealogical Society Benefit

I believe that it can be beneficial to genealogists to belong to several genealogical societies. A society benefits its members through networking and resources that the society provides. One case in point is the National Genealogical Society (NGS).

NGS recently announced that members can now access digitized versions of their NGS Quarterly from 2002-2006.

In their most recent email "What is New at the National Genealogical Society" (15 January 2008) they state:

The National Genealogical Society is proud to announce its latest online membership benefit. NGS Members can now access recent issues (2002-2006) of the NGS Quarterly. Current issues and limited back issues will be coming online periodically.
